Elisabeth Moss stars-in, produces and directs Apple TV+ Series SHINING GIRLS, debuting soon on Apple TV+. See the new Trailer here!
Synopsis:
Based on Lauren Beukesâ best-selling novel, âShining Girlsâ follows Kirby Mazrachi (Moss) as a Chicago newspaper archivist whose journalistic ambitions were put on hold after enduring a traumatic assault. When Kirby learns that a recent murder mirrors her own case, she partners with seasoned, yet troubled reporter Dan Velazquez (played by Wagner Moura), to uncover her attackerâs identity. As they realize these cold cases are inextricably linked, their own personal traumas and Kirbyâs blurred reality allow her assailant to remain one step ahead. In addition to Moss and Moura, the gripping drama stars Phillipa Soo, Amy Brenneman and Jamie Bell. âShining Girlsâ is adapted for television and executive produced by Silka Luisa, who also serves as showrunner.
Elisabeth Moss stars, directs and executive produces through Love and Squalor Pictures, alongside Lindsey McManus. Leonardo DiCaprio, Jennifer Davisson and Michael Hampton executive produce through Appian Way. Michelle MacLaren directs and executive produces with Rebecca Hobbs for MacLaren Entertainment. Daina Reid directs and executive produces. Author Lauren Beukes and Alan Page Arriaga also serve as executive producers.
Apple TV+ release SHINING GIRLS Friday, April 29, 2022.

By Justin Waldman
Disney+‘s latest Limited Series gives audiences a first time look at a brand- new Marvel character, Moon Knight. This is the first time that Marvel has given audiences a show that introduced a main character into the MCU via a show instead of a film. Moon Knight needs the span of a series to flesh-out his character and ideology, which might have been lost amongst the shorter runtime of a film. We get almost six hours to know his character and understand his powers.
The Series centers on Marc Spector/Steven Grant (Oscar Isaac), a worker at a museum in London, there is nothing exciting or particularly interesting about his character at first. That is until he comes home, and we see him shackle himself to his bed as he has a tendency to sleep walk and wander off. This is where things take a turn for the weird, as he becomes a completely different person and is somehow in Europe fighting mercenaries.
As the Show continues, we find out that Marc/Steven are actually a symbiote in essence for a Moon God named Khonshu (F. Murray Abraham) and he is really Moon Knight, a protector of secrets who ensures that evil does not reign supreme. Without giving away too much, Arthur Harrow (Ethan Hawke) who is an assistant to the Egyptian god Ammit, who weighs peoplesâ good and bad through touch, and if it turns out theyâre evil (or are going to commit a heinous act) he kills them in the name of Ammit.
What works really well in Moon Knight are the performances from both Oscar Isaac and Ethan Hawke. Both manage to deliver on the chaos and passion their respective characters face, and even with the jarring aspects of the Show, they manage to hold our attention and make us crave more. Isaac plays in essence, three separate characters and delivering one of the most specific British accents, manages to deliver some sheer joy and unintentional chuckles. He captures Moon Knight‘s essence and makes him an unstoppable force. Hawke is quite possibly the most menacing heâs ever been on-screen. He proves that he can be terrifying and rather unnerving in his portrayal of Arthur Harrow but this captivates the audience and wants you to indulge further into the character and have a lingering sense of fear.
Moon Knight is risky for Marvel. It is unconventional and pushes the boundaries of what audiences are expecting from their properties. It almost feels hyperbolic to say that this is unlike any Marvel property audiences have seen thus far, because it is such a clichĂ© to state that, however Moon Knight is unlike anything weâve seen by Marvel. It refuses to adhere to linear storytelling. While there is a lot going on at times especially when switching between Mark and Steven, the risks paid off. It seems that going to smaller Filmmakers is the direction the Studio is going with, and honestly this innovation continues to help them thrive with their best output yet. Taika Waititi‘s Thor Ragnarok is a prime example of that, but so is the choice to have aboard Series Directors Justin Benson and Aaron Moorhead. If this is the future of Marvel, investing in creative minds and letting them shine, and we will continue to get things like Moon Knight that break the mold, then it is a very promising future ahead.
MOON KNIGHT streams on Disney+ Wednesdays at 12am PT/3am ET starting with Episode One on Wednesday March 30th, 2022.

The 94th annual Academy Awards returned once again to Dolby Theatre as Cinema’s most prestigious night had altered course during the Pandemic. Taking top honours was Sian Heder‘s CODA, taking Best Picture. The Film is the first-ever Film with a predominantly Deaf Cast to win Best Picture. It premiered at Sundance in 2021, before selling to Apple for a record $25 million, proving a smart investment. The Film written and directed Heder, is based on the 2014 French coming-of-age film La Famille BĂ©lier, centering on a young woman who is the child of deaf parents.
In addition to winning Best Picture, CODA also won Heder Best Adapted Screenplay and Troy Kotsur would take Supporting Actor.
Other major winners included Will Smith for his work in KING RICHARD, landing him Best Actor, proving third time’s the charm after having been nominated thrice for an Oscar.
Jessica Chastain gained much momentum in recent weeks, taking Best Actress for her portrayal of Tammy Faye Bakker in THE EYES OF TAMMY FAYE. This also was her third time being nominated for an Oscar, proving once again that third time’s the charm!
Best Director went to Jane Campion for THE POWER OF THE DOG, which was seen as the favourite to win Best Picture. She has the distinction of being the third woman ever to win the category.
Hosted by a Trio of Wanda Sykes, Amy Schumer and Regina Hall, the night was not without drama. Funnyman Chris Rock when presenting Best Documentary, poked fun at Jada Pinkett Smith‘s baldness which landed him a slap on-stage from eventual Will Smith, in defense of his wife.

Nobody brings them to the Movies like Sandra Bullock! THE LOST CITY debuts atop the Box Office with a strong $31 million for Paramount Pictures from 4,253 theatres. The Film has the distinction of the biggest opening for a female-driven Film since the Pandemic started. The Comedy also starring Channing Tatum and Daniel Radcliffe, gets 76% on the Tomatometer.
THE BATMAN is in second this weekend with $20.5 million from 3,967 theatres for Warner Bros. This brings its domestic run to $332 million.
Third spot goes to Bollywood Action/Drama RRR â RISE ROAR REVOLT with $9.5 million from 1,200 theatres for Sarigama Cinemas.
UNCHARTED pulls-in $5 million for Sony Pictures, bringing its total to $133.5 million.
JUJUTSU KAISEN 0: THE MOVIE is fifth with $4.5 million for Funimation, a two week total of $27 million. Very impressive for a niche genre release.

The talented Humberly Gonzalez (the “H” is silent) made an appearance tonight at ONSCREEN/BACKSTAGE, an event put-on by the Femme Fatale Film Festival celebrating local female Filmmakers, BIPOC Filmmakers and the work of marginalized Creators. The event took place at charming Annex haunt BAMPOT HOUSE OF TEA & BOARD GAMES, an intimate affair with Short Films like REVERENCE by Teaunna Gray was shown. The Documentary centers on an anti-slavery convention that had taken place at Toronto’s St. Lawrence Hall in the 1850s.
See the Short Film here:
Gonzalez is based now in Toronto by way of Montreal, born in Venezuela. Things are taking off very-quickly for the disarming Actress. She starred as Sophie Sanchez in popular Netflix Series GINNY & GEORGIA, which is wrapping-up its second season soon. She also will star in FALLEN ANGELS MURDER CLUB, a series of TV Movies starring Toni Braxton coming April 2, 2022 and the following week April 9, 2022 to Lifetime in the U.S. The Movies will be airing at a later date on CTV Drama in Canada. This is a huge year for her as she stars in Toronto-set STAY THE NIGHT which just premiered at SXSW earlier this month, and she stars alongside Jason Momoa in Francis Lawrence’s Slumberland, coming soon as well!

Nicole Kidman executive produces upcoming Apple TV+ Anthology Series ROAR, based on stories be Cecelia Ahern, spanning many genres. Your first look at the Trailer.
Synopsis:
Roar is an anthology series of darkly comic feminist fables. Spanning genres from magical realism to psychological horror, these eight stand-alone stories feature ordinary women in some pretty extraordinary circumstances. In âRoar,â women eat photographs, date ducks, live on shelves like trophies. And yet, their struggles are universal.
The gripping trailer highlights the award-winning cast of actors that star across the eight distinct stories, including Academy, Emmy and Golden Globe Award winner Nicole Kidman (âBeing the Ricardosâ), who also executive produces; Emmy, Grammy and Tony Award winner Cynthia Erivo (âHarrietâ); six-time Emmy Award-nominee Issa Rae (âInsecureâ); Emmy Award winner Merritt Wever (âUnbelievableâ); SAG Award nominee Alison Brie (âHappiest Season,â GLOW); three-time Emmy Award-nominee Betty Gilpin (âGLOW,â âThe Tomorrow Warâ); Meera Syal (âYesterdayâ), Fivel Stewart (âAtypicalâ) and Kara Hayward (âUsâ).
Each instalment of the anthology series will also feature notable stars such as Nick Kroll (âBig Mouthâ), Judy Davis (âNitramâ), Alfred Molina (âSpider-Man: No Way Homeâ), Daniel Dae Kim (âLostâ), Jake Johnson (âNew Girlâ), Jason Mantzoukas (âBig Mouthâ), Chris Lowell (âGLOWâ), Ego Nwodim (âSaturday Night Liveâ), Griffin Matthews (âThe Flight Attendantâ), Peter Facinelli (âYesterYearâ), Simon Baker (âThe Mentalistâ), Hugh Dancy (âLaw & Orderâ), Jillian Bell (âBrittany Runs a Marathonâ), Bernard White (âEvil Eyeâ), Justin Kirk (âWeedsâ) and more.
ROAR arrives on Apple TV+ Friday, April 15, 2022.
